(Sioux Falls, SD) The Fintech Ops Data Specialist supports daily reconciliation activities across National Products, ensuring that all financial activity posted to bank accounts aligns with cardholder transactions and network funds movement. This role operates in a fast‑paced environment and provides critical oversight to maintain accuracy, integrity, and timeliness of financial data across multiple systems.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
Perform daily reconciliation of National Products accounts across multiple financial systems, including payment gateways, digital wallets, card processors, banks, and internal ledgers. Research and resolve discrepancies to maintain aging items under the 90-day aging standard. Assist in creating and maintaining accurate program funds flows. Support team members in resolving complex reconciliation issues for existing products. Work with Deposit Operation team to resolve outstanding ACH items. Partner with the data warehouse team to ensure accurate reporting for daily transaction activity. Verify that new products are in the flat files and reflected accurately in the daily recon reporting. Utilize existing SQL queries to troubleshoot issues and identify efficiencies. Analyze data in the flat files & understand how it affects operations and the overall products within National Products. Work with Processors, Program Managers and Database team on recon difference resolution. Assist with implementation efforts for new products or processes. May be asked to coach, mentor, or train others as subject matter expert when it comes to FinTech Reconciliation. Prepare and provide requested documentation or information for Audit requests.
